the subject line reminded me of one of the first laptop performances i ever
saw: jim o'rourke, in 1997 or 98, in a warehouse/gallery type space in
Chelsea, NYC. there was no stage, jim was set up at an ordinary table with
his G3.

halfway through his set, a young woman made her way through the audience to
jim's table, and began talking to him as he performed:

girl :  hey, when's the next band on?
jim : [distracted] .....uhhh, they're on right now
girl : [confused] really? who are they?
jim : ...it's me!
girl : [looks confused; walks away]
